Trauma Bar und Kino announces Songs for Attunement, featuring durational performances from Colin Self, Iceboy Violet, Steven Warwick, Golin & more, Jul 1—3

15 June 2022

Trauma Bar und Kino presents Songs for Attunement, an “exhibition of live works” featuring durational performances on July 1 and 3.

With performative installations from six artists including Colin Self, Iceboy Violet and Steven Warwick, the project will immerse Trauma Bar und Kino in activations spanning spoken word, movement and electronics. Also featuring Golin, Lil Asaf and Stine Janvin, the events explore the terms ‘attunement’ and ‘enaction’—borrowed from psychology and biology—to dissolve barriers of traditional musical performance. As noted in the press release: “Without beginning or end, and without the separation of “stage”, visitors can engage with the artists (and vice-versa) with no predictable linearity or outcome. The live works function individually, but also as a whole, creating a sonic/performative ecosystem, with the body and the voice both medium and artwork.”

Lagrima plays with embrace & longing on the heartfelt ballad of ‘Raindrops’

10 June 2022

Lagrima is releasing EP eyes still closed via kit on June 17, with preview track ‘Raindrops’ premiering on AQNB today. The artist’s debut record follows appearances on Ola Radio and JEROME, in addition to a host of live performances mainly across France.

‘Raindrops’ delivers a tender yet short-lived ballad. Arpeggiated synths bubble between the thumping beat, ushering in Lagrima’s autotune to complete the track’s euphoric sound. The lyrics describe a fleeting intimacy, conjuring a parallel between embrace and the rain, a theme that dances throughout the up-tempo composition until the beat falls out. Glowing atmospherics leave a nostalgic feeling at the close.**

Lagrima’s EP eyes still closed is out via kit on June 17.

Exploring the human, ecological crisis & technological imaginaries at the geodesic dome vivarium of Arizona’s Biosphere 2, with the Terra [Alterities] group show

23 May 2022

Terra [Alterities], a group exhibition presented by Supercollider and featuring K Allado-McDowell, Benjamin Bratton, Alice Bucknell, Paige Emery among others, was on at Biosphere 2, Oracle, Arizona, running May 6 to 8.

Alice Bucknell, Green Mars World (2022). Installation view. Image courtesy the artist + Supercollider, Los Angeles.

Set at the world’s largest closed ecological system, built in the late ’80s to investigate off-world living, the exhibition — which also features Xin Liu, Laure Michelon, Sahej Rahal, and Yasaman Sheri — explores notions of the human in our ecological crisis-ridden present, among techno-fix imaginaries and Buckminster Fuller-inspired geodesic domes. As noted in the exhibition text: “What types of languages might emerge from the growing consciousness of a global catastrophe of our own making?”**

The Terra [Alterities] group exhibition, presented by Supercollider and curated by Paige Emery and Laure Michelon, was on at Oracle, Arizona’s Biosphere 2, running May 6 to 8, 2022.

Dj Clope shares the cathartic trance of ‘Ligar’ for Endless Bazaar’s debut compilation, Endless Bazaar Experience Vol. 1

29 April 2022

Endless Bazaar is releasing compilation Endless Bazaar Experience Vol. 1 on May 5, with preview track ‘Dj Clope – Ligar’ premiering on AQNB today. It’s the first release from the bi-monthly club night in Lucerne, featuring artists such as dj lostboi, REA, Elbis Rever, and others in celebration of DIY music culture.

Dj Clope’s ‘Ligar’ starts with lush synthetic soundscapes punctured by a mix of Brazilian baile funk beats and vocals. Arpeggios elevate the track’s pacing before descending into the main break, recalling Elysia Crampton’s ‘DJ E’ edits that blend Latin American rhythms with ethereal ambient samples. Suddenly, the composition releases a cathartic trance, youthful vocals trailing between melodic atmospherics before finally drifting away.**

Endless Bazaar’s compilation Endless Bazaar Experience Vol. 1 is out on May 5.
